Oilers forward Jordan Eberle is nominated for the Lady Byng Trophy. It's awarded to the player who shows sportsmanship while playing at a high level.
The other nominees are Florida defenceman Brian Campbell and Islanders forward Matt Moulson.
Eberle led the Oilers in scoring with 76 points in 78 games while recording only 10 penalty minutes. He's looking to become the third Oiler to win the Lady Byng. Wayne Gretzky won it in 1979-80 followed by Jari Kurri in 1984-85.
The NHL awards will be given out June 20 in Las Vegas. (jrw)
